Is Komazawa-Daigaku Station (Japan) Worth Visiting?
Komazawa-Daigaku Station in Setagaya, Tokyo, is all about offering a blend of local charm and convenient access to some of Tokyo's most appealing attractions. Known for its proximity to Komazawa Olympic Park, a sprawling green space perfect for a relaxing day out, the station is a popular spot for both locals and tourists seeking a respite from the city's hustle.
The area around the station boasts a friendly, laid-back atmosphere with a variety of shops and eateries catering to the student population of nearby Komazawa University. This gives it a unique appeal, making it a worthwhile visit for those looking to experience a more authentic side of Tokyo.
Opening Hours & Best Time to Visit Komazawa-Daigaku Station (Japan)
Planning your visit to Komazawa-Daigaku Station? Knowing the best time to visit will help you make the most of your trip. Here's a quick guide to help you plan your visit.
- Opening Hours: Komazawa-Daigaku Station operates according to the train schedule, typically from around 5:00 AM to 1:00 AM daily.
- Best Time to Visit: The best time to see Komazawa Olympic Park, which is the main attraction near the station, is during the spring (March to May) for the cherry blossoms or autumn (September to November) for the vibrant foliage.
- Busy vs. Less Busy: Weekends tend to be busier, especially when there are events at the park. Weekdays, particularly Tuesdays and Wednesdays, are generally less crowded.
- Estimated Visit Duration: Allow at least 2-3 hours to explore Komazawa Olympic Park and the surrounding area.

How Much to Enter / Visit Komazawa-Daigaku Station (Japan)
Planning your trip and wondering about tickets, passes, or tour prices? Here's what you need to know about visiting Komazawa-Daigaku Station.
- Tickets: Entry to Komazawa-Daigaku Station is based on the train fare, which varies depending on your starting point. You'll need a valid train ticket or a Japan Rail Pass if applicable.
- Komazawa Olympic Park: Entry to Komazawa Olympic Park is free.
- Pricing Variations: Train fares are generally the same on weekends and weekdays. Children's fares are typically half the adult fare.
- Where to Buy: Train tickets can be purchased at ticket vending machines inside the station or using a rechargeable travel card like Suica or Pasmo.
